Engineering for the Long Haul
The secret behind the Anker Rave Party 3s lies in its dual-driver configuration paired with advanced digital signal processing (DSP). By focusing on bass extension and mid-range clarity, the unit ensures that vocals and drum beats translate clearly across open spaces. This is a critical distinction because outdoor environments lack the reflective surfaces of an indoor room, which usually help amplify sound. By pushing more energy into the lower frequencies, the speaker compensates for the lack of acoustic reinforcement provided by walls.

Common Mistakes in Choosing Outdoor Sound
One of the biggest blunders people make is buying multiple small speakers instead of one robust unit. You might think that spreading small, cheap speakers around the area creates a better soundscape, but it actually introduces latency issues and creates a cluttered environment. A single, powerful source like the Anker Rave Party 3s creates a centralized focal point for the energy of your gathering. It is easier to control, easier to charge, and significantly more durable than a cluster of smaller, delicate electronics.
